"Partout" is mainly used as adverb meaning "absolutely", "by all means" or "insistently". It is also used as particle.

2.) "Emphasizes absolute impossibility or negation"
"Partout", when used with this meaning, acts as particle.
- Definition: "Emphasizes the impossibility or negation of something."
- Translation(s): absolutely not, by no means, definitely not, under no circumstances
- Synonym(s): absolut, keinesfalls
- Antonym(s): möglich, wahrscheinlich
- Related word(s): unmöglich, ausgeschlossen
📝 Some usage examples:
- Er wollte partout nicht zuhören.
- Sie konnte partout nicht verstehen, warum.
- Er wird partout nicht zustimmen.
